Small gold ring with pyramid pattern, 4.62 grams, size 4, approx. 12K, ex-1715 Fleet. ¾" in diameter, ¼" wide. Small (by today's standards but not at the time of manufacture), well-made ring with twelve four-sided gold pyramid shapes around the perimeter, no engraving on the interior, typically low fineness. From the 1715 Fleet (Corrigan's site, found in 1982), with photo-certificate from the finder (Buddy Martin).
